Home-Based Hearing Test with Smartphone Applications-A Prospective Study
Lara Carvalho1, Jawad Abdulla, Inez Dale-Jones
1Otolaryngology Department, Royal Surrey County Hospital, Guildford, UK.
Summary
Smartphone hearing test apps show high accuracy for identifying hearing loss. These tools, e-audiologia (EHT) and Yuichi Sakashita (YSHT), correlate well with traditional pure tone audiometry (PTA), suggesting potential for widespread use.
Area of Science:
- Audiology
- Digital Health
- Medical Diagnostics
Background:
- Smartphone applications (Apps) have surged in healthcare use post-COVID-19.
- Self-hearing test Apps are now accessible on Android and iOS platforms.
- The diagnostic accuracy of these mobile health tools requires investigation.
Purpose of the Study:
- To evaluate the diagnostic accuracy of smartphone self-hearing test Apps.
- To compare app-based hearing assessments with conventional pure tone audiometry (PTA).
Main Methods:
- Prospective study of 38 adult patients (age 20-68) at an Audiovestibular Medicine Clinic.
- Utilized e-audiologia (EHT) for Android and Yuichi Sakashita (YSHT) for iOS.
- Compared app-derived hearing thresholds against gold standard PTA, defining hearing loss based on specific decibel levels at key frequencies.
Main Results:
- Combined Apps achieved 100% sensitivity and 76% specificity.
- Strong positive correlation (p < 0.001) observed between app thresholds and PTA.
- Maximum mean difference between app and PTA thresholds was 10.5-dB HL at 500 Hz.
Conclusions:
- EHT and YSHT Apps demonstrate significant potential for hearing screening and disorder monitoring.
- These apps can be integrated into primary care, audiology clinics, nursing homes, and public health initiatives.
- Smartphone hearing tests offer a viable tool for accessible audiological assessment.
